Abstract

本实用新型公开了一种电子设备固定支架,包括一固定底座,所述固定底座用于固定到一固定物;一夹具,所述夹具用于夹持一电子设备;一设置在所述固定底座上的支撑杆结构,所述第一支撑杆的另一端与所述底座的转动连接的转动方向与所述第一支撑杆的一端与第二支撑杆的一端可转动连接的转动方向分别在两个互相垂直的平面内。这样,可方便调节支架与使用者的距离及相对角度,而且结构简单,制造也方便。

The utility model discloses an electronic equipment fixing bracket, comprising a fixing base, the fixing base is used to be fixed to a fixed object; a clamp, the clamp is used to clamp an electronic device; a support rod structure arranged on the fixing base, the rotation direction of the other end of the first support rod and the rotation direction of the rotational connection between the base and the first end of the first support rod and the second end of the second support rod are respectively in two mutually perpendicular planes. In this way, the distance and relative angle between the bracket and the user can be conveniently adjusted, and the structure is simple and the manufacturing is also convenient.

背景技术Background technique

由于电脑资料传送及储存能力的快速进步,使得电子阅读或播放器,例如,智能手机、平板电脑的应用越来越普及;尤其是苹果公司推出“iphone”、“ipad”等系列产品,受到消费者的欢迎,除了进行通讯外,越来越多人还使用这类设备作为阅读器来阅读文章或作为播放器来观看电影,甚至玩游戏等其它娱乐节目;在使用过程中,大部分人习惯用手捧着这些电子阅读器,或者将电子阅读器搁置台面,眼睛和身体趋附屏幕;这些使用方法容易产生疲累感,使得电子阅读器的长时间使用受到一定的限制;为方便使用,通常使用一固定支架用来固定电子阅读或播放器,这种固定支架可以固定在桌面、座椅或床等家具的边缘上。Due to the rapid progress of computer data transmission and storage capabilities, the application of electronic reading or players, such as smart phones and tablet computers, has become more and more popular; especially the series of products such as "iphone" and "ipad" launched by Apple Inc. have been popular among consumers. In addition to communication, more and more people use this type of device as a reader to read articles or as a player to watch movies, or even play games and other entertainment programs; during use, most people are used to Hold these e-readers with your hands, or put the e-readers on the countertop, and your eyes and body are close to the screen; these methods of use are prone to fatigue, which limits the long-term use of e-readers; for convenience, usually use A fixing bracket is used to fix the electronic reader or player, and this fixing bracket can be fixed on the edge of furniture such as a desktop, a seat or a bed.

现有的电子设备固定支架包括一以承载电子阅读器的夹具,可与床、书桌、家具等固定物固定的底座以及一柔性杆,该柔性杆可以向各个方向弯曲从而可以调节支座与使用者的距离及相对角度。但是,这种调节距离的柔性杆制造成本高,而且,如果刚性太高,调节不方便,但是如果刚性小,又不能支撑起较重的电子阅读器。另外现有的电子阅读器固定支架是利用一类似夹子的结构的夹具来夹持电子阅读器,夹持不太稳定,特别是使用时间长了就不能很好地夹紧。还有,固定底座也是利用一类似夹子的结构来夹持家具等固定物的边,同样也不太稳定和稳固。The existing electronic device fixing bracket includes a clamp to carry the electronic reader, a base that can be fixed with fixed objects such as a bed, a desk, and furniture, and a flexible rod that can be bent in various directions so that the support and the use of the device can be adjusted. distance and relative angle. However, the manufacturing cost of the flexible rod for adjusting the distance is high, and if the rigidity is too high, the adjustment is inconvenient, but if the rigidity is small, it cannot support a heavy electronic reader. In addition, the existing e-reader fixing bracket utilizes a clamp with a structure similar to a clip to clamp the e-reader, and the clamping is not very stable, especially when it is used for a long time, it cannot be clamped well. In addition, the fixed base also utilizes a structure similar to a clip to clamp the edges of fixtures such as furniture, which is also not very stable and firm.

具体实施方式Detailed ways

为了使本实用新型实现的技术手段、创作特征、达成目的与功效易于明白了解,下面结合具体图示,进一步阐述本实用新型。In order to make the technical means, creative features, goals and effects achieved by the utility model easy to understand, the utility model will be further elaborated below in conjunction with specific illustrations.

参见图1所示,本实用新型公开了一种电子设备固定支架,包括用于对支架进行安装固定的固定底座100、设置在固定底座100上且用于对夹持的电子设备进行角度/方向或距离进行调节的支撑杆200、用于夹持电子设备的夹具300以及用于将夹具300和支撑杆200活动连接在一起的滑动件400。夹具300通过滑动件400可在支撑杆200上上下滑动;本实用新型的电子设备可以为,但不限定为,平板电脑(ipad)或手机(iphone)等显示或通讯设备。Referring to Fig. 1, the utility model discloses a fixing bracket for electronic equipment, which includes a fixing base 100 for installing and fixing the bracket, which is arranged on the fixing base 100 and is used for adjusting the angle/direction of the clamped electronic equipment. Or the support rod 200 for adjusting the distance, the clamp 300 for clamping the electronic device, and the sliding member 400 for movably connecting the clamp 300 and the support rod 200 together. The clamp 300 can slide up and down on the support rod 200 through the slider 400; the electronic device of the present invention can be, but is not limited to, a display or communication device such as a tablet computer (ipad) or a mobile phone (iphone).

参见图2所示,本实用新型电子设备固定支架的固定底座100设置为U形结构,U形结构的开口110为夹持口,在安装和固定本实用新型的电子设备固定支架时,该夹持口可以用于夹住被夹物体面板或面板的边缘从而对该支架进行固定。设置为U形结构相比其它夹持结构具有更好的夹持效果,因为其与被夹物体的接触面积大,夹持更加稳定。上述所指的被夹物体可以为床头、书桌、柜子等具有平板面或薄型柱体。Referring to shown in Fig. 2, the fixing base 100 of the electronic equipment fixing bracket of the present utility model is arranged as a U-shaped structure, and the opening 110 of the U-shaped structure is a clamping opening. When installing and fixing the electronic equipment fixing bracket of the utility model, the clip The holding mouth can be used to clamp the panel of the clamped object or the edge of the panel so as to fix the bracket. Compared with other clamping structures, the U-shaped structure has a better clamping effect, because it has a larger contact area with the clamped object, and the clamping is more stable. The clamped objects mentioned above can be bedsides, desks, cabinets, etc. with flat surfaces or thin cylinders.

更具体地,固定底座100由第一支撑件120、第二支撑件130以及可将第一、第二支撑件连接在一起的调节件140组成,第一支撑件120和第二支撑件130组装在一起时形成上述夹持口110,调节件140能够调节和控制第一支撑件120和第二支撑件130之间的夹持口110大小(图中上下距离的大小),从而使得固定底座100能够稳定夹持厚度不同的床头、书桌、柜子等平板面结构的面板,进一步提高本发明的支架的实用性;在该实施例中,调节件140为一端部带有旋钮的螺栓,顺时针旋动螺栓可以将固定底座夹紧在被夹物体上,逆时针旋动螺栓可以增大固定底座的夹持厚度或松开夹持(具体参见下面的描述)。More specifically, the fixed base 100 is composed of a first support 120, a second support 130, and an adjustment member 140 that can connect the first and second supports together. The first support 120 and the second support 130 are assembled Together, the clamping opening 110 is formed, and the adjusting member 140 can adjust and control the size of the clamping opening 110 between the first support 120 and the second support 130 (the size of the upper and lower distances in the figure), so that the fixed base 100 It can stably clamp panels with flat structures such as bedsides, desks, and cabinets with different thicknesses, further improving the practicability of the bracket of the present invention; in this embodiment, the adjusting member 140 is a bolt with a knob at one end, clockwise Turning the bolt can clamp the fixed base on the clamped object, and turning the bolt counterclockwise can increase the clamping thickness of the fixed base or loosen the clamping (see the description below for details).

参见图3和图4所示,第一支撑件120包括第一水平支撑面121以及与第一水平支撑面121成90°角连接的第一竖直支撑面122,第一水平支撑面121与第一竖直支撑面122可为一体成型结构,这样加工工艺简单,加工成本低,当然也可以分开制造再固定在一起;第一竖直支撑面122上设有第一缺口122a,第一缺口122a两侧面的中部设有沿第一缺口122a侧面(上下)长度方向延伸的第一滑槽122b;第一水平支撑面121上设有贯穿第一水平支撑面的螺纹孔121a,螺纹孔121a用于安装调节件140。螺纹孔121a是一通孔,位于第一水平支撑面121上,位于第一竖直支撑面122的第一缺口122a的范围内(见图4)。3 and 4, the first support member 120 includes a first horizontal support surface 121 and a first vertical support surface 122 connected at an angle of 90° to the first horizontal support surface 121, and the first horizontal support surface 121 is connected to the first horizontal support surface 121. The first vertical support surface 122 can be integrally formed, so that the processing technology is simple and the processing cost is low. Of course, it can also be manufactured separately and then fixed together; the first vertical support surface 122 is provided with a first gap 122a, the first gap The middle part of both sides of 122a is provided with the first chute 122b extending along the length direction of the side of the first notch 122a (up and down); the first horizontal support surface 121 is provided with a threaded hole 121a penetrating through the first horizontal support surface, and the threaded hole 121a is used for To install the adjusting part 140. The threaded hole 121a is a through hole located on the first horizontal support surface 121 and within the range of the first notch 122a of the first vertical support surface 122 (see FIG. 4 ).

参见图5和图6所示,第二支撑件130包括第二水平支撑面131以及与第二水平支撑面131成90°连接的第二竖直支撑面132,第二水平支撑面131与第二竖直支撑面132可为一体成型结构,这样,加工工艺简单,加工成本低,当然也可以分开制造再固定在一起;第二竖直支撑面132上沿垂直方向上设有内螺纹孔132a,该内螺纹孔132a与第二水平支撑面131成90°设置;第二竖直支撑面132的左右两侧面上设有沿侧面长度方向延伸的突条132b,该突条132b与上述第一滑槽122b相对应:在安装时,当第二竖直支撑面132卡合在第一竖直支撑面122的第一缺口122a内(参见图2),第二竖直支撑面132左右两侧面上的突条132b可分别嵌入到第一缺口122a两侧面中部的第一滑槽122b中并可自由滑动,这样第二竖直支撑面132(包括整个第二支撑件130)可在第一滑槽122b内自由滑动,由于上述螺纹孔121a与内螺纹孔132a位置相对应,这样,第二竖直支撑面132上内螺纹孔132a的中心轴线与第一水平支撑面121上螺纹孔121a的中心轴线在一条直线上,内螺纹孔和螺纹孔就形成调节件140的安装孔。调节件140采用一螺栓,在安装时,先将带旋钮的螺栓穿过到螺纹孔121a内(参见图2),然后到内螺纹孔132a上,转动调节件140,深入到第二竖直支撑面132的内螺纹孔132a中的螺纹部分的转动会带动第二支撑件130上下运动,这样,第一支撑件120的第一水平支撑面121与第二支撑件130的第二水平支撑面131之间的距离(开口110的大小)就可以调节,这样,通过转动调节件140就可以调节固定底座100夹紧床头、书桌、柜子等平板面结构的面板,从而使得固定底座能够夹持厚度不同的面板,提高了支架的稳固性。5 and 6, the second support member 130 includes a second horizontal support surface 131 and a second vertical support surface 132 connected at 90° to the second horizontal support surface 131, and the second horizontal support surface 131 is connected to the second horizontal support surface 131. The two vertical supporting surfaces 132 can be integrally formed, so that the processing technology is simple and the processing cost is low. Of course, they can also be manufactured separately and then fixed together; the second vertical supporting surface 132 is provided with an internally threaded hole 132a along the vertical direction. , the internally threaded hole 132a is set at 90° to the second horizontal support surface 131; the left and right sides of the second vertical support surface 132 are provided with a protruding strip 132b extending along the length direction of the side surface, and the protruding strip 132b is connected to the above-mentioned first The chute 122b corresponds to: during installation, when the second vertical support surface 132 is engaged in the first notch 122a of the first vertical support surface 122 (see FIG. 2 ), the left and right sides of the second vertical support surface 132 The protruding strips 132b on the top can be respectively embedded in the first sliding grooves 122b in the middle of the two sides of the first notch 122a and can slide freely, so that the second vertical supporting surface 132 (including the entire second supporting member 130) can slide in the first sliding position. Sliding freely in the groove 122b, because above-mentioned threaded hole 121a corresponds to the position of internally threaded hole 132a, like this, the central axis of internally threaded hole 132a on the second vertical support surface 132 and the center of threaded hole 121a on the first horizontal support surface 121 The axes are on a straight line, and the internally threaded hole and the threaded hole form a mounting hole for the adjusting member 140 . The adjusting part 140 adopts a bolt. When installing, first pass the bolt with the knob into the threaded hole 121a (see Figure 2), then go to the internal threaded hole 132a, turn the adjusting part 140, and go deep into the second vertical support The rotation of the threaded portion in the internally threaded hole 132a of the surface 132 will drive the second support member 130 to move up and down, so that the first horizontal support surface 121 of the first support member 120 and the second horizontal support surface 131 of the second support member 130 The distance between them (the size of the opening 110) can be adjusted. In this way, by turning the adjusting part 140, the fixed base 100 can be adjusted to clamp the panels of flat surface structures such as bedsides, desks, cabinets, etc., so that the fixed base can clamp the thickness Different panels improve the stability of the stand.

在该实施例中,由于本实用新型的支架的固定底座100采用两个L型的第一支撑件120和第二支撑件130相互嵌入的方式连接,而相互之间的距离通过嵌入的边框相互滑动来调节,显然,这种通过突条132b嵌入到第一滑槽122b的结构相比现有固定底座,其夹持的稳定性更好、适用范围广,而且受力后不宜变形。In this embodiment, since the fixed base 100 of the bracket of the present invention adopts two L-shaped first support members 120 and second support members 130 to be connected with each other, the distance between them is determined by the embedded frames. Obviously, this structure embedded into the first slide groove 122b through the protruding strip 132b has better clamping stability and wide application range than the existing fixed base, and it is not easy to deform after being stressed.

为了减少固定底座与被夹物体之间的摩擦,提高固定底座的夹持的稳定性以及保护被夹物体表面,本实用新型在第一水平支撑面121以及第二水平支撑面131的内表面均设有橡胶垫150(见图3和图5)。In order to reduce the friction between the fixed base and the object to be clamped, improve the clamping stability of the fixed base and protect the surface of the object to be clamped, the utility model has both inner surfaces of the first horizontal support surface 121 and the second horizontal support surface 131. A rubber pad 150 is provided (see FIG. 3 and FIG. 5 ).

另外,第二竖直支撑面132上的突条132b在第一滑槽122b内滑动工作时,由于长时间工作,突条132b与第一滑槽122b的内壁之间会产生摩擦,从而导致第一滑槽122b扩大,扩大的第一滑槽122b与突条132b之间在配合时不会紧密贴合,其会影响固定底座安装时的稳定性;如果将整个第一支撑件120换成新的,则浪费成本。In addition, when the protrusion 132b on the second vertical support surface 132 slides in the first chute 122b, due to long-time work, there will be friction between the protrusion 132b and the inner wall of the first chute 122b, resulting in the first One chute 122b is expanded, and the enlarged first chute 122b and the protruding bar 132b will not fit closely when mating, which will affect the stability of the fixed base when installed; if the entire first support member 120 is replaced with a new , it is a waste of cost.

参见图7所示,为了解决上述问题,本实用新型的另一个实施中,在第一滑槽122b内设有带滑槽161的第一滑槽件160,第一滑槽件160通过一螺钉固定在第一滑槽122b内;安装时,第二竖直支撑面132卡合在第一缺口122a内,这样,第二竖直支撑面132左右两侧面上的突条132b就分别嵌入到第一滑槽件160的滑槽161内,且可在第一滑槽件160内的滑槽161内自由滑动;此时突条132b的大小需要设置成与第一滑槽件160的滑槽161大小相对应,这样即使第一滑槽件160的滑槽161受到摩擦而扩大不能很好的使用时,也只需更换第一滑槽件160即可,而无需更换整个第一支撑件120,大大节约了成本。Referring to Fig. 7, in order to solve the above problems, in another implementation of the present utility model, a first chute member 160 with a chute 161 is provided in the first chute 122b, and the first chute member 160 is passed through a screw fixed in the first chute 122b; during installation, the second vertical support surface 132 is engaged in the first notch 122a, so that the protruding strips 132b on the left and right sides of the second vertical support surface 132 are respectively embedded in the second vertical support surface 132 in the chute 161 of a chute piece 160, and can slide freely in the chute 161 in the first chute piece 160; Corresponding in size, even if the chute 161 of the first chute 160 is enlarged due to friction and cannot be used well, only the first chute 160 needs to be replaced instead of the entire first support 120, Greatly save costs.

参见图8和图9所示,本实用新型支撑杆200包括与第一连接件210连接的第一支撑杆220、与第一支撑杆220连接的第二连接件230以及与第二连接件230连接的第二支撑杆240组成。8 and 9, the utility model support rod 200 includes a first support rod 220 connected to the first connecting member 210, a second connecting member 230 connected to the first supporting rod 220, and a second connecting member 230 connected to the second connecting member 230. connected second support rod 240.

第一连接件210包括第一固定端211和第一连接端212,第一固定端211可通过螺钉等固定件固定在固定底座100的第一支撑件120的第一水平支撑面121上,当螺钉没有完全旋紧时,第一连接件210可在第一水平支撑面121上绕垂直方向的轴自由转动;第一支撑杆220的一端与第一连接件210之间通过一轴销250连接,这样第一支撑杆220通过轴销250可在垂直于第一水平支撑面121的内进行前后一定范围,例如0-60°,范围内的翻转,这样也可以直接用来调节夹持的电子设备带人观看眼睛之间的距离或角度;第二连接件230包括第二固定端231和第二连接端232,第二固定端231可通过一螺栓或螺钉与第一支撑杆220的另一端连接,当该螺栓没有完全锁紧时,第二连接件230也通过该螺栓绕着第一支撑杆220围绕垂直于第一支撑杆220的长度方向进行360°(纵向)转动;第二连接端232通过一螺钉或螺栓与第二支撑杆240的一端连接,当该螺钉没有完全锁紧时,第二支撑杆240可绕着第二连接件230与第二支撑杆240长度方向平行的方向进行360°(横向)转动;这样采用上述结构的支撑杆结构可以对电子阅读器进行任意方向和角度进行调节,从而满足客户方便地调节对本实用新型的固定电子阅读器的支架的观看距离的不同要求。当然,拧紧上述螺钉或螺栓可以停止上述转动而定位。The first connecting member 210 includes a first fixed end 211 and a first connecting end 212. The first fixed end 211 can be fixed on the first horizontal support surface 121 of the first support member 120 of the fixed base 100 by a fixing member such as a screw. When the screw is not fully tightened, the first connecting member 210 can freely rotate around the axis in the vertical direction on the first horizontal support surface 121; In this way, the first support rod 220 can be flipped in a certain range, such as 0-60°, within a range perpendicular to the first horizontal support surface 121 through the pivot pin 250, so that it can also be directly used to adjust the clamping electronic The device takes people to watch the distance or angle between the eyes; the second connecting member 230 includes a second fixed end 231 and a second connecting end 232, and the second fixed end 231 can be connected to the other end of the first support rod 220 by a bolt or screw connection, when the bolt is not fully locked, the second connecting member 230 also rotates 360° (longitudinal) around the first support rod 220 around the length direction perpendicular to the first support rod 220 through the bolt; the second connection end 232 is connected to one end of the second support rod 240 through a screw or bolt, when the screw is not fully locked, the second support rod 240 can be moved around the second connecting piece 230 in a direction parallel to the length direction of the second support rod 240 360° (horizontal) rotation; in this way, the support rod structure of the above structure can adjust the electronic reader in any direction and angle, so as to meet the different requirements of customers to conveniently adjust the viewing distance of the bracket for fixing the electronic reader of the present invention . Certainly, tightening above-mentioned screw or bolt can stop above-mentioned rotation and position.

参见图9,本实用新型第二支撑杆240的内部设有沿第二支撑杆长度方向设置的长槽241,长槽241的两侧面上各设有一沿长槽两侧面长度方向延伸的凸条241a,该凸条可一体成型在侧面上形成轨道。Referring to Fig. 9, the interior of the second support rod 240 of the present utility model is provided with a long groove 241 arranged along the length direction of the second support rod, and each side surface of the long groove 241 is provided with a convex strip extending along the length direction of the two sides of the long groove 241a, the raised strip can be integrally formed to form a track on the side.

再参见图10和图11所示,滑动件400包括夹具固定件410和滑动块420,夹具固定件410背对夹具300的一侧面中部设有安装孔411,安装时,螺钉通过安装孔411将夹具固定件410固定在夹具300的中部位置;滑动块420的两侧面上开设有凹槽421,此凹槽421的大小与第二支撑杆240上的长槽241两侧面上的凸条241a相对应,其在安装时正好能将凸条241a容纳,从而使得滑动块400能够在第二支撑杆240的长槽241内上下滑动,以便用于带动的夹具300能沿第二支撑杆240上下移动,其也可以用来随时调节电子阅读器的高度或角度。Referring again to Fig. 10 and Fig. 11, the slider 400 includes a clamp fixing part 410 and a sliding block 420, and the middle part of the side of the clamp fixing part 410 facing away from the clamp 300 is provided with a mounting hole 411. During installation, screws pass through the mounting hole 411 to The clamp fixing part 410 is fixed at the middle position of the clamp 300; the two sides of the sliding block 420 are provided with grooves 421, and the size of the grooves 421 is equivalent to the protrusions 241a on the two sides of the long groove 241 on the second support bar 240. Correspondingly, it can just accommodate the convex strip 241a during installation, so that the sliding block 400 can slide up and down in the long groove 241 of the second support rod 240, so that the clamp 300 used for driving can move up and down along the second support rod 240 , which can also be used to adjust the height or angle of the e-reader at any time.

参见图11,本实用新型滑动块420与夹具固定件410连接的一端设有一内嵌在滑动块420内的圆形槽422,滑动块420上还设有一贯穿滑动块的通孔423.该通孔423的水平中心轴线通过圆形槽422的圆心,且与圆形槽422垂直;夹具固定件410和滑动块420通过一连接块430连接,连接块430包括圆柱形连接头431和矩形连接头432,圆形连接头431的中部设有贯穿圆形连接头的圆孔431a,安装时,先将圆形连接头431安置在滑动块420的圆形槽422内,然后将一插销从滑动块420上的通孔423的一端插入,并通过圆形连接头431中部的圆孔431a,最终从滑动块上通孔423的另一端出来;最后将矩形连接头432可转动的安装在夹具固定件410的一安装孔内;该连接块430也可以使得夹具300能够绕连接块430的矩形连接头进行纵向(围绕连接块430的长度方向的轴)旋转,以及绕插销轴(通孔423的长度方向)进行例如0°-60°一定范围内的上下翻转;采用上述结构的滑动件也可以进一步对电子阅读器进行高度、方向的调节,从而满足不同客户的多方面需求。Referring to Fig. 11 , one end of the sliding block 420 of the present invention connected to the fixture fixture 410 is provided with a circular groove 422 embedded in the sliding block 420, and a through hole 423 is provided on the sliding block 420. The through hole The horizontal central axis of the hole 423 passes through the center of the circular groove 422 and is perpendicular to the circular groove 422; the fixture fixture 410 and the sliding block 420 are connected by a connecting block 430, and the connecting block 430 includes a cylindrical connecting head 431 and a rectangular connecting head 432, the middle part of the circular connector 431 is provided with a circular hole 431a that runs through the circular connector. One end of the through hole 423 on the 420 is inserted, and passes through the round hole 431a in the middle of the circular connector 431, and finally comes out from the other end of the through hole 423 on the sliding block; finally, the rectangular connector 432 is rotatably installed on the fixture fixture 410 in a mounting hole; the connection block 430 can also enable the clamp 300 to rotate longitudinally (the axis around the length direction of the connection block 430) around the rectangular connection head of the connection block 430, and rotate around the pin axis (the length of the through hole 423 direction) to flip up and down within a certain range, such as 0°-60°; the slider with the above structure can also further adjust the height and direction of the e-reader, so as to meet the various needs of different customers.

参见图12和图13所示,本实用新型夹具300包括支撑体310以及设置在支撑体310两端部的夹持件320,支撑体310的内部设有一从内部中间位置延伸至支撑体两端部的腔体311,腔体由左、右腔体组成。且两腔体之间也通过隔板312分开,当然也可以相通;夹持件320为L形,其包括长端321和短端322,两个夹持件320的长端321分别设置在支撑体310的腔体311内,其短端322露在支撑体310端部外侧并与支撑体310端部成约90°设置,电子阅读器则在安装时可被夹持在两短端322之间。Referring to Fig. 12 and Fig. 13, the fixture 300 of the present invention includes a support body 310 and clamping pieces 320 arranged at both ends of the support body 310, and the inside of the support body 310 is provided with a The cavity 311 of the part is composed of left and right cavities. And the two cavities are also separated by a partition 312, and of course they can also be connected; the clamping part 320 is L-shaped, and it includes a long end 321 and a short end 322, and the long ends 321 of the two clamping parts 320 are respectively arranged on the support In the cavity 311 of the body 310, its short end 322 is exposed outside the end of the support body 310 and is arranged at an angle of about 90° to the end of the support body 310. The electronic reader can be clamped between the two short ends 322 during installation. between.

为了提高两夹持件320之间的夹持力度和能够满足不同尺寸的夹持要求,本实用新型在夹持件长端321上设有安置槽321a,在安置槽321a内可设有弹性件330,并且将弹性件330的一端与夹持件320或其短端322连接,另一端与支撑体310连接;通过弹性件330将夹持件320与支撑体310内部连接,且通过拉伸短端322可使两夹持件320相向向外运动,从而来改变夹具300的夹持尺寸(两短端322之间的距离);本实用新型中该弹性件330由左右各两根弹簧组成,通过两夹持件320的伸缩可以调节它们的短端322之间的距离,从而达到可以夹持不同尺寸电子阅读器的要求,采用左右各两根弹簧的组合也提高了夹持的力度;本实用新型弹性件不必限定为左右各两根弹簧组成,其根据实际需要还可以设定为其它个数,此处不加赘述。另外,短端322上与所夹持的电子设备接触的部位可以形成一定的固定结构,如卡钩结构,便于进一步进一步稳固(卡住)所夹持的电子设备。In order to improve the clamping strength between the two clamping parts 320 and to meet the clamping requirements of different sizes, the utility model is provided with a placement groove 321a on the long end 321 of the clamping part, and an elastic part can be arranged in the placement groove 321a 330, and one end of the elastic member 330 is connected to the clamping member 320 or its short end 322, and the other end is connected to the support body 310; the clamping member 320 is connected to the support body 310 through the elastic member 330, and by stretching the short The end 322 can make the two clamping parts 320 move outwards, thereby changing the clamping size of the clamp 300 (the distance between the two short ends 322); in the utility model, the elastic part 330 is composed of two springs on the left and right, The distance between the short ends 322 of the two clamping parts 320 can be adjusted through the expansion and contraction, so as to meet the requirement of clamping e-readers of different sizes, and the combination of two springs on the left and right also improves the clamping strength; The elastic part of the utility model is not necessarily limited to two springs on the left and right sides, and it can also be set to other numbers according to actual needs, and will not be described in detail here. In addition, the portion of the short end 322 that is in contact with the clamped electronic device can form a certain fixed structure, such as a hook structure, so as to further stabilize (clamp) the clamped electronic device.
